Output e54d28057a1ce19aee1251389b395b1b5b5f618f66dce56ae79d3fef71e36963:17

value
150000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e04a340f412b41d8ec08bd60f7d45b83a482c550 OP_EQUAL
address
3N8xBFes72Lx95AyVBf95xDzdc4pi83dc1
transaction
e54d28057a1ce19aee1251389b395b1b5b5f618f66dce56ae79d3fef71e36963
spent
true